Loft Plumbing in Denver, CO
Loft plumbing services encompass a range of projects related to the plumbing systems located in attic or upper-level spaces of a home. These services typically include installing, repairing, or replacing pipes, fixtures, and drainage systems that run through the loft area. Homeowners often request loft plumbing work when upgrading or renovating their attic, addressing leaks or blockages, or ensuring proper water supply and waste removal in upper-level spaces. Understanding the scope of the project, including the existing plumbing layout and any potential access challenges, is important before requesting service.
Property owners usually want to know whether the plumbing work will involve significant alterations to their existing system, if permits are necessary, and how the work might impact other parts of the home. Clarifying the specific issues-such as leaks, low water pressure, or clogged drains-and discussing the overall goals for the loft plumbing can help ensure the project meets expectations. Proper planning and communication about the plumbing layout and any potential modifications are key steps before scheduling services.

Common Loft Plumbing Jobs
Leak detection and repair - identifying and fixing hidden or visible plumbing leaks to prevent water damage.
Drain cleaning services - clearing clogs and blockages to restore proper flow in sinks, toilets, and main lines.
Water heater installation and repair - ensuring reliable hot water supply through proper setup and maintenance.
Fixture installation - replacing or upgrading sinks, faucets, toilets, and other plumbing fixtures.
Pipe replacement and rerouting - updating aging or damaged pipes to improve system reliability.
Emergency plumbing services - prompt assistance for urgent plumbing issues to minimize property damage.
Loft Plumbing Questions
What plumbing services are available for lofts? Services include installing new plumbing lines, repairing leaks, and upgrading fixtures to improve functionality and efficiency.
Can plumbing be added to an existing loft? Yes, additional plumbing can be installed to support bathrooms, kitchens, or laundry areas in loft spaces.
What should property owners know about plumbing upgrades in lofts? Proper planning ensures adequate water pressure, drainage, and compliance with building codes for safe and reliable operation.
Are leak repairs common in loft plumbing? Leaks can occur due to aging pipes or damage, and prompt repairs help prevent water damage and maintain system integrity.
